Lake in the Hills is a village in McHenry County, Illinois, renowned for its significant residential growth during the 1990s. Once a quaint lakeside village, it transformed into a bustling suburb with a nearly 400% population increase. The area is ideal for families and those looking for a suburban lifestyle with the convenience of nearby Chicago. The community offers a peaceful environment with ample residential options, making it a desirable location for those seeking a balance between urban and suburban living.

Spring is a pleasant time to visit with mild weather and blooming nature.
Summers are warm, perfect for outdoor activities and exploring local parks.
Fall offers beautiful foliage and a quieter atmosphere as the tourist season winds down.
Winters can be cold, but the village is charming and peaceful during this time.
